Advantages of Bamboo Fencing

Bamboo fencing offers numerous benefits that make it a popular choice among eco-conscious homeowners. Most notably, bamboo is a fast-renewing resource that matures significantly quicker than standard timber, which aids in curbing deforestation. Its innate strength and long-lasting nature form a solid barrier that holds up well against diverse weather conditions. Furthermore, bamboo fencing is light in weight and straightforward to install, making it an ideal choice for DIY enthusiasts. The decorative allure of bamboo lends a one-of-a-kind, natural character to any property, harmonizing beautifully with outdoor environments. Moreover, bamboo has natural pest-repellent properties, reducing the need for chemical treatments. By opting for bamboo, homeowners can both improve their outdoor areas and make a meaningful contribution to environmental sustainability.

Sustainable Plastic Options

Recycled plastic fencing offers an innovative and eco-friendly alternative for eco-minded property owners. Made from post-consumer plastic waste, this type of fencing prevents waste materials from entering landfills while providing long-lasting durability with minimal upkeep. Resistant to rot, insects, and weather, recycled plastic fencing maintains its appearance over time, reducing the requirement for periodic replacements. Available in various styles and colors, it is capable of replicating the look of natural wood while delivering superior long-term durability. Moreover, this sustainable fencing solution plays a role in minimizing carbon footprints, as the production method generally demands less energy than producing new plastic materials. Those in search of sustainable fencing alternatives might view recycled plastic fencing as a functional and aesthetically pleasing selection for their yards and outdoor areas.

Preserving Your Eco-Friendly Fence

Although maintaining an eco-friendly fence may seem straightforward, it demands careful consideration to ensure its durability and environmental integrity. Periodic examinations ought to be carried out to spot any evidence of wear or damage, most notably in naturally sourced materials like timber. Washing the fence using eco-friendly biodegradable soaps can aid in stopping mold and mildew from forming without damaging the environment.

In addition, applying organic protective treatments, like linseed oil, can enhance overall durability while upholding environmental friendliness. Homeowners and residents should also pay attention to surrounding plant life; unchecked plant growth are known to cause damage and attract unwanted pests. Trimming back foliage promotes adequate airflow and professional guide minimizes the buildup of moisture.

Additionally, when making repairs, using recycled or sustainably sourced materials complements eco-friendly principles. By putting time and effort into upkeep, homeowners can protect their eco-friendly fences, ultimately supporting a sustainable lifestyle while enhancing the aesthetic appeal of their properties.
